If you live in Menston or nearby, are new to church or just browsing, we hope you will find the information you are looking for.

Our deepest desire is to pursue our church's life in the way we believe Jesus would wish.

You will find us on Main Street in the middle of Menston - almost opposite the Malt Shovel pub!
There is a small car park to the right hand side of the church. The building is wheelchair accessible.

Our community cafe, Cornerstone, immediately adjoins the main church building.

 



The best way to meet us is at our 10.30am Sunday morning service.
You will receive a warm welcome whatever your age or background.

Our Sunday services are either held in the Church or our main hall which offers a more
relaxed and informal style of service, including cafe church.

We offer activities for young people on a Sunday morning in our Sun Club.

If you are wanting to explore faith or have questions about life's big issue, we hold
Alpha courses in Cornerstone Cafe.
